Abstract

A method for characterizing a device under test includes propagating multiple optical signals through the device under test and combining the multiple optical signals with a reference optical signal. The multiple optical signals are mixed with the reference optical signal and a relative perturbation between the multiple optical signals from the mixing of the multiple optical signals with the reference optical signal is determined. In another embodiment a modulated optical signal is provided from a local oscillator and the modulated optical signal is combined with the input optical signal. The modulated optical signal is mixed with the input signal to provide a mixed signal and at least one polarization-resolved parameter of the input optical signal is extracted from the mixed signal.

Claims (16)

1. A method for characterizing a device under test, comprising:

propagating multiple optical signals through the device under test, the multiple optical signals including multiple sideband pairs, each sideband pair having a positive sideband and a negative sideband, and the positive sideband and the negative sideband of a particular sideband pair having a substantially same polarization state;

combining the multiple optical signals with a reference optical signal;

mixing the multiple optical signals with the reference optical signal; and

for each of at least one sideband pair, determining a relative perturbation between the positive sideband and the negative sideband of the sideband pair, from the mixing of the multiple optical signals with the reference optical signal.

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ining at least one elementary parameter from the determined relative perturbation, the at least one elementary parameter including at least one of the following:

a group delay, a 0° component of the differential group delay, a 45° component of the differential group delay, a circular component of the differential group delay, an absorption change per unit frequency, a frequency derivative of a 0° component of the polarization dependent loss, a frequency derivative of a 45° component of the polarization dependent loss, and a frequency derivative of a circular component of the polarization dependent loss.
